Skip to main content
itin.net
U.S. Bank Account guide for mobile app developers based in Mauritania
Banking12 min read

U.S. Bank Account for mobile app developers from Mauritania

Mobile app developers in Mauritania need a U.S. bank account for app store royalties. Learn the requirements, process, and common pitfalls for opening one remotely.

Reviewed by , ITIN Specialist at itin.net.

U.S. Bank Account Friction for Mauritanian App Developers

Mobile app developers in Mauritania face a specific hurdle when their apps generate revenue through U.S.-based platforms like Apple's App Store or Google Play. These platforms often require developers to have a U.S. bank account to receive payouts efficiently. Without one, developers may encounter delays, higher transaction fees due to currency conversions, or even an inability to receive their earnings. The primary challenge is opening such an account remotely from Mauritania, as most U.S. banks have strict requirements for in-person verification or U.S. residency. This creates a barrier for talented developers who wish to monetize their skills in the global digital marketplace. The need for a U.S. bank account is directly tied to the operational requirements of the app stores, which are designed around the U.S. financial system. For developers in Mauritania, this means navigating a system that wasn't built with them in mind. Understanding the specific documentation and application processes is key to overcoming this obstacle and ensuring timely access to earned revenue. This is where specialized services can simplify the process, bridging the gap between Mauritanian residency and U.S. banking requirements. itin.net helps non-residents establish the necessary U.S. financial infrastructure.

When a U.S. Bank Account Becomes Necessary

A U.S. bank account is typically required for mobile app developers in Mauritania when they begin earning significant revenue through app store sales and in-app purchases (IAPs) processed by Apple or Google. Both Apple and Google mandate that developers provide U.S. tax information to comply with U.S. tax law, specifically regarding withholding on royalties. For non-U.S. persons, this often involves obtaining an Individual Taxpayer Identification Number (ITIN) and filling out forms like the W-8BEN or W-8BEN-E. To facilitate the payment of these royalties, the app stores strongly prefer or require a U.S. bank account. This is because they operate primarily within the U.S. financial system and payouts are most easily made in U.S. dollars to U.S. accounts. While some platforms might offer international wire transfers, these can be costly and less reliable for regular payouts. The U.S. tax forms themselves, such as those related to withholding, are designed with the expectation that recipients will have a U.S. financial nexus, making a U.S. bank account a practical, if not always strictly mandatory, component of the payout process. Failure to provide the necessary banking details can lead to delayed payments or funds being held until compliance is achieved. This is particularly true for developers aiming for substantial earnings, where the efficiency and cost-effectiveness of a U.S. account become paramount.

Required Documentation for Non-Residents

Opening a U.S. bank account remotely from Mauritania necessitates specific documentation to satisfy Know Your Customer (KYC) and Anti-Money Laundering (AML) regulations. The exact requirements vary by bank, but common documents include a government-issued identification document, such as a valid passport. You will also need proof of address, which can be a utility bill or bank statement from Mauritania, demonstrating your residential status. For business accounts, which are often more suitable for developers operating professionally, additional formation documents are required. These can include Articles of Organization or Incorporation, and potentially an EIN confirmation letter if the business is structured as a U.S. LLC or corporation. The EIN, or Employer Identification Number, is crucial for U.S. business entities and is obtained by filing Form SS-4 with the IRS. Some banks may also request a business plan or details about the nature of your business activities. For mobile app developers, this might involve explaining your app's function, revenue streams, and projected earnings. The itin.net service can assist in gathering and preparing these documents. Remember that clarity and completeness are key; any missing or unclear information can lead to application delays or rejections. Even fintech alternatives like Mercury, Relay, or Brex, while often more accessible to non-residents, still require thorough documentation to verify identity and business legitimacy.

The Remote Application Process and Timeline

The process for opening a U.S. bank account remotely from Mauritania typically begins with selecting a financial institution that accepts non-resident applicants. This often means looking beyond traditional large U.S. banks, which frequently require in-person visits, and considering fintech solutions or smaller community banks. Once a suitable institution is identified, you will complete their specific application form. This is not a federal form but rather a bank-specific KYC/AML application. You will need to upload or submit the required documentation discussed previously, including identification, proof of address, and business formation documents if applicable. The application is then reviewed by the bank's compliance department. This review process can take several business days. If approved, the bank will establish your account. You will then receive your account details, and typically a debit card will be mailed to your address. The entire process, from initial application submission to having an active debit card, usually takes between 5–10 business days. However, this timeline can be extended if there are issues with the application, missing documents, or a high volume of applications at the bank. It is advisable to start this process well in advance of needing the funds to be accessible, especially considering potential mail delays to Mauritania. Some services, like itin.net, streamline this by helping to ensure your application is complete and correctly submitted from the outset.

Common Pitfalls for Mauritanian App Developers

Mobile app developers in Mauritania often encounter specific pitfalls when attempting to open a U.S. bank account. A primary mistake is applying to U.S. banks that have a strict policy against opening accounts for non-residents without a U.S. physical presence or a U.S. registered entity. Many large national banks fall into this category, making them unsuitable from the start. Another common issue is missing or incomplete documentation. This includes failing to provide a clear copy of your passport, an insufficient proof of address, or incorrect business formation documents for a U.S. LLC or other entity. For those operating as a business, attempting to open an account without an EIN, especially if required by the bank or for tax purposes, is a frequent oversight. Developers may also underestimate the importance of matching information across all documents; discrepancies in names or addresses can lead to rejections. Furthermore, relying solely on a personal address in Mauritania for a business account can sometimes raise red flags. Understanding that a U.S. business entity, like a U.S. LLC, often simplifies the banking process is also key. Many Mauritanian developers are unaware that forming a U.S. LLC can facilitate easier access to U.S. banking and business services. The requirements for tax forms like Form 5472, which reports transactions with a foreign-owned U.S. LLC, also necessitate proper setup. Consulting with a service experienced in assisting non-residents, such as itin.net for EIN and U.S. business formation, can help avoid these common mistakes.

The Certified Acceptance Agent (CAA) Advantage

For non-residents like mobile app developers in Mauritania applying for an ITIN, the path through a Certified Acceptance Agent (CAA) offers significant advantages over applying directly to the IRS. itin.net operates as a CAA. When you apply for an ITIN through a CAA, the agent is authorized by the IRS to verify your original identification documents, such as your passport. This means you do not have to mail your original, irreplaceable documents to the IRS, which can take months to be returned and carries a risk of loss. The CAA performs a direct examination of your identification and certifies that it meets IRS standards. This certification process significantly speeds up the ITIN application and reduces the risk associated with sending original documents. Furthermore, a CAA can assist with the accuracy of your ITIN application (Form W-7), helping to prevent errors that could lead to delays or rejections. While a CAA does not guarantee ITIN approval, their expertise in the application process can improve the likelihood of a smooth and efficient experience. This is particularly valuable for individuals in Mauritania who may not have easy access to U.S. embassy services for document verification. Using a CAA like itin.net means your identity documents are verified locally by an IRS-authorized agent, simplifying a critical step in establishing your U.S. tax presence.

Next Steps for Mauritanian Developers

After successfully opening a U.S. bank account, the next practical steps for mobile app developers in Mauritania involve ensuring ongoing compliance and optimizing your U.S. financial operations. You will need to manage the received funds, which may include transferring them to your Mauritanian accounts or reinvesting them into your business. Keep meticulous records of all transactions for tax purposes. If you formed a U.S. LLC, remember to file the annual reports required by the state of formation and to comply with U.S. tax filing obligations, such as filing Form 5472 and a U.S. income tax return if applicable, even if no tax is due. The U.S. tax system can be complex, especially for non-residents. Understanding your U.S. tax residency status and any applicable tax treaties (though none exist between the U.S. and Mauritania) is important. For developers who have obtained an ITIN, you will need to file U.S. tax returns annually if you have U.S. sourced income. This ensures continued compliance with the IRS and avoids penalties. Consider consulting with a U.S. tax professional experienced in non-resident taxation to ensure all obligations are met. For those who have not yet established their U.S. financial and tax infrastructure, exploring services like those offered by itin.net for U.S. bank accounts, EINs, and ITIN applications is a logical starting point. Reviewing the pricing for these services or contacting itin.net directly can provide clarity on how to proceed.

Practical tips

  • Use the same legal name across all your applications (U.S. bank account, ITIN, U.S. LLC formation) as it appears on your passport to avoid identity verification issues.
  • Ensure your proof of address document from Mauritania is recent (within the last 3 months) and clearly displays your name and residential address.
  • If forming a U.S. LLC, choose a reputable registered agent service and ensure you understand the ongoing compliance requirements, including state filings and Form 5472.
  • When applying for a U.S. bank account, clearly articulate your business model as a mobile app developer, detailing revenue sources (app sales, IAPs) and projected income to satisfy bank due diligence.
  • Factor in potential delays for mail delivery to Mauritania when ordering debit cards or any physical banking materials; allow extra time beyond the estimated 5-10 business days for account activation.

Frequently asked questions

Can I open a U.S. bank account from Mauritania without visiting the U.S.?

Yes, it is possible to open a U.S. bank account remotely from Mauritania. Many fintech companies and some traditional banks offer solutions for non-residents, though requirements can be strict. You will typically need to provide extensive documentation for verification.

What U.S. tax forms do I need as a mobile app developer from Mauritania?

You will likely need to obtain an ITIN by filing Form W-7. You will also need to complete IRS Form W-8BEN (for individuals) or W-8BEN-E (for entities) to declare your foreign status and claim any applicable withholding tax treaty benefits, though the U.S. does not have an income tax treaty with Mauritania. If you form a U.S. LLC, you'll need to file Form 5472.

How long does it take to get a U.S. bank account opened remotely?

The typical timeline for opening a U.S. bank account remotely for non-residents is 5–10 business days from the submission of a complete application to having an active account and debit card. However, this can vary depending on the bank and the completeness of your documentation.

Is an EIN required to open a U.S. bank account for my app development business?

An EIN is required if you form a U.S. business entity like a U.S. LLC or corporation and the bank requires it for business accounts. Even if not strictly required by the bank, obtaining an EIN is often a necessary step for U.S. business operations and tax compliance, especially if you plan to hire employees or operate as a formal business entity. itin.net can assist with obtaining an EIN.

What if my U.S. bank account application is rejected?

If your application is rejected, carefully review the reason provided by the bank. Common reasons include incomplete documentation, issues with identity verification, or the bank's specific policies on non-resident accounts. You may need to gather additional documents or consider applying to a different financial institution that better suits non-resident requirements. Services like itin.net can help identify suitable options.

Will I need to pay U.S. taxes on my app revenue if I'm based in Mauritania?

U.S. tax obligations depend on the source and nature of your income. Royalties from U.S. app stores are considered U.S. sourced income. While there is no income tax treaty between the U.S. and Mauritania, you will likely face a U.S. withholding tax on these royalties. You may also have filing requirements, such as Form 5472 for a U.S. LLC, even if no tax is ultimately owed. Consulting a U.S. tax professional is recommended.

Ready to Apply for Your ITIN?

Our IRS-Certified Acceptance Agents make the process simple and remote — from anywhere in the world.

  • IRS Certified
  • 5–10 Business Days
  • Money-Back Guarantee